One shot on devastator's and berserker's heads
a few shots to a devastator body with enough stagger to hard stun them
two shots to berserker's body with enough stagger to stun
two shots on a strider's "crotch" or legs
Can one shot a overseer in the head (you have to hit usually around the middle or lower half of the head otherwise you lose some damage to deflection angles and it won't kill)
1 shot on observers in the eye or two in the body
(ps. the overseer breakpoint is the most important difference between it and other primaries to me because it is far easier to hit them only once in the head than twice, especially with how they bobble around when getting hit)
